A » Professionals should approach customizing pet oral hygiene by first assessing each pet's specific needs, considering factors such as age, breed, and diet. It's essential to recommend appropriate products like toothbrushes and pet-safe toothpaste, and to educate pet owners on proper brushing techniques. Regular dental check-ups and cleanings by a veterinarian can further ensure optimal oral health. Tailoring care plans for individual pets can prevent dental issues and enhance overall wellbeing.
